Virunga National Park rangers follow Dodi, a 2-year-old bloodhound, during a search-and-rescue exercise in the park, about 28 miles north of Goma, Democratic Republic of Congo. Three bloodhounds are used in the park for search and rescue as well as for tracking poachers. The past four months have brought some of the worst violence in years to Congo, forcing about 280,000 people to abandon their homes as the rebels have taken control of a huge swath of the country.

A female fin whale opens its mouth as it lies stranded on the beach at Carlyon Bay in St. Austell, England. Rescuers had hoped to refloat the whale, a globally endangered species and the second-largest animal on the planet, but it died on the beach.

A baby rhinoceros named Akili stands next to her mother, Ine, in their enclosure at the zoo in Berlin. The rhino was born on Aug. 6 and belongs to the black rhinoceros species, which is native to the eastern and central areas of Africa and classified as critically endangered.
